The Minister of state for external affairs V K Singh has told the Lok Sabha that India has also told China that there cannot be selective approach when it comes to terrorism and in a blocking India's bid at the United Nations to proscribe Jaish-e-Mohammed chief Masood Azhar, has said it is exerting diplomatic pressure to remove the technical hold and get a ban imposed on him.


Meanwhile China had blocked India's bid at the UN to ban Azhar, the Jaish-e-Mohammad (JeM) chief and mastermind of the Pathankot terror attack. China is among the five permanent members of the UN Security Council (UNSC) and has veto powers and the others are France, Russian Federation, the UK, and the US.


The external affairs minister Sushma Swaraj in a written reply has said a large number of countries have supported India's initiatives for reform of the Security Council, as well as endorsed India's candidature for permanent membership.


Sushma Swaraj has stated that a 10 member analytical support and sanctions monitoring team (monitoring team) which comprises of independent experts assist the sanctions committee depending on the vacancies available.
